David Bowie's majestic presence...

Need we say more? Probably not, but we’re going to anyway. The hair. Those tights. That juggling ability (okay, it wasn’t actually him but we reckon he can pull it off with panache). Some SERIOUS swagger. Watching Labyrinth, we fear Bowie, but love him too (obvs) as he brings that unmistakable charisma to the role of Jareth the Goblin King. Who else could steal a baby, make a teenage girl tackle death defying traps (not to mention risk smelling hideous for all time!), attempt to possess her forever and STILL win us over? There were whispers that Prince, Mick Jagger and Michael Jackson were considered for the role in the early stages of production but we think it’s impossible to imagine anyone else doing it quite like Bowie.

Can you defeat the Labyrinth or will Jareth turn Toby into a goblin babe? You have 13 hours to find out with this epic board game base on the classic Labyrinth movie by Jim Henson. Each player takes on the role of either Sarah, Hoggle, Ludo, or Didymus and much like the film, players have '13 hours' to navigate Jareth's labyrinth to rescue baby Toby. The gameplay is designed to be fast-paced, family friendly, and open for up to four players.

The game consists of two distinct stages, one where the group must adventure through the labyrinth trying to find the goblin city whilst keeping their willpower as high as possible (nobody wants to fall into the oubliette!), and a second action packed stage where the players must fight their way into Jareth's castle where Sarah must say the magical words that will release her brother.
